Which vessels carry the blood to the kidneys? Whether this blood venous or arterial?
Expert
The arterial vessels that carry the blood to be filtrated through the kidneys are the renal arteries. The renal arteries are the ramifications of the aorta and thus, the blood which is filtered through the kidneys is arterial i.e. oxygen-rich) blood.
